Protect Your Rights: How Tenant Eviction Lawyers Can Help You

Facing eviction is a stressful and overwhelming experience for any tenant. Whether you are dealing with a non-payment of rent issue, lease violation, or any other dispute with your landlord, it is crucial to know your rights and seek legal help if necessary. In such situations, tenant eviction lawyers can be your best ally to guide you through the legal process and ensure your rights are protected.

Eviction laws vary from state to state, so it is essential to consult with a knowledgeable attorney who specializes in landlord-tenant law in your jurisdiction. tenant eviction lawyers are well-versed in the intricacies of eviction laws and know how to navigate the legal system to protect your rights as a tenant. They can provide you with valuable advice on your rights and options, help you understand the eviction process, and represent you in court if necessary.

One of the most significant benefits of hiring a tenant eviction lawyer is that they can help you understand your rights as a tenant. Many tenants are unaware of the protections afforded to them under the law, and landlords may take advantage of this lack of knowledge. A lawyer can inform you of your rights under the lease agreement and state laws, including the legal reasons for eviction, proper notice requirements, and the timeline for the eviction process.

Additionally, a tenant eviction lawyer can help you respond to eviction notices and court filings from your landlord. They can review the notice to ensure that it complies with legal requirements and advise you on the best course of action. If you choose to fight the eviction, your lawyer can represent you in court and present your case effectively to the judge.

Moreover, tenant eviction lawyers can negotiate with your landlord on your behalf to reach a settlement that is fair and favorable to you. They can explore options such as repayment plans, lease modifications, or relocation assistance to avoid eviction altogether. If negotiation is unsuccessful, your lawyer can represent you in court and defend your rights during the eviction proceedings.

In cases where eviction is unavoidable, a tenant eviction lawyer can help you understand the eviction process and your rights as a tenant. They can guide you through the court proceedings, represent you in court hearings, and ensure that your landlord follows the proper legal procedures. Your lawyer can also help you explore options such as appealing the eviction judgment or seeking a stay of execution to delay the eviction.
